Abstract

We demonstrated rapid detection of SARS-CoV-2 nucleocapsid protein antigen by dual-comb biosensing with surface modification of its corresponding antibody. A sensitivity close to that of RT-PCR was achieved, thanks to the use of active–dummy temperature compensation.
